Understanding Muscle Growth

Muscle growth, or hypertrophy, occurs when muscle fibers are repaired and enlarged after stress-inducing activities such as weightlifting. Two key factors play a role:

  1. Muscle Protein Synthesis (MPS): The body’s process of rebuilding and strengthening muscle fibers.  

  2. Hormonal Influence: Growth hormones and other anabolic agents drive the process of muscle repair and growth.
